Governance structure

[GOV-1] 

The Śnieżka Group is managed by the Management Board and supervised by the Supervisory Board of the parent company. Śnieżka SA exercises control over its subsidiaries primarily through exercising voting rights at shareholders’ general meetings, and in the case of Rafil – at the shareholders’ meeting.

The number of Management Board members, including: 5
Women 1
Men 4
Percentage of women on the Management Board 20%
Percentage of men on the Management Board 80%
The number of Supervisory Board members, including:
Women 1
Men 6
Percentage of women on the Supervisory Board 14%
Percentage of men on the Supervisory Board 86%
Percentage of independent Supervisory Board members 43%

In 2024, none of the Members of the Management Board or Supervisory Board in the Group held the position of worker’s representative.

Jerzy Pater 
Chairman of the Supervisory Board
Co-founder of Śnieżka and an experienced practitioner in the construction chemicals industry, associated with it from the beginning of his professional career. He has many years of experience in the production of paints and varnishes and management of production processes. Since 2003, he has co-run the company PPHU Elżbieta i Jerzy Pater Sp. z o.o., specializing in the production and sale of construction materials. He has been a member of the Supervisory Board of Śnieżka for over 20 years, participating in the company’s strategic decisions

Independence: NO

Stanisław Cymbor 
Vice-Chairman of the Supervisory Board
Co-founder of Śnieżka, brings experience in the construction chemicals sector to the Supervisory Board. He has a university education in the field of administration. He has been a member of the Supervisory Board of Śnieżka for over 20 years, participating in the company’s strategic decisions. Since 2003, he has been conducting his own business activity (PPHU Iwona i Stanisław Cymbor Sp. z o.o.) and is also active in the real estate market.

Independence: NO

Rafał Mikrut 
Secretary of the Supervisory Board
Manager with over 25 years of experience in the construction chemicals industry. He has a university education in the field of management and marketing, and his professional career has focused from the very beginning on the paints and varnishes sector. As co-owner of 2M Sp. z o.o., he manages the sales strategy and product development. As a member of the Supervisory Board of Śnieżka since 2018, he has brought knowledge in the field of operational business management in the industry in which Śnieżka operates.

Independence: NO

Zbigniew Łapiński 
Member of the Supervisory Board 
Economist with managerial and investment experience in an international environment. He has been cooperating with investment funds for many years and serves on supervisory boards and strategic committees of several companies – both public and private. He has been a member of the Supervisory Board of Śnieżka since 2004, providing substantive support in the area of ​​financial management, investments and corporate supervision.

Independence: NO

Anna Sobocka 
Member of the Supervisory Board 
Expert in finance, accounting and auditing. She is a certified auditor and also holds the following certificates: FCCA (Association of Chartered Certified Accountants), CIA (Certified Internal Auditor) i CFE (Certified Fraud Examiner). She gained managerial and consulting experience in renowned consulting firms, as well as a financial director in FMCG companies and a member of supervisory boards. Currently, she serves as the Chief Financial Officer at Pluton Kawa Sp. z o.o. She has been a member of the Supervisory Board of Śnieżka since 2023 and chairs the Audit Committee, providing professional supervision over the area of ​​financial reporting, regulatory compliance and internal audit.

Independence: YES
Chairwoman of the Audit Committee

Piotr Kaczmarek 
Member of the Supervisory Board
Capital markets expert with over 20 years of experience in investment analysis and management. He holds the CFA (Chartered Financial Analyst) designation and a securities broker license. He has managed share portfolios in the largest pension funds in Poland – ING OFE and AVIVA OFE – and also has held analytical, investment and management positions in banking and investment fund companies. As a member of supervisory boards and audit committees of many listed companies, he has contributed to unique competences in the field of corporate governance, corporate supervision, investment strategies and financial risk assessment. He has been a member of the Supervisory Board and Audit Committee of Śnieżka since 2022, contributing his competences in the field of accounting and the effectiveness of the company’s financial management.

Independence: YES
Member of the Audit Committee

Dariusz Orłowski 
Supervisory Board 
Manager with over 25 years of experience in business management. Since 2001, he has been the CEO of Wawel SA. Previously he held managerial and director positions at KrakChemia SA and Gellwe. He specializes in the areas of corporate finance, operational management and corporate governance. He has been a member of the Supervisory Board of Śnieżka since 2011 and a member of the Audit Committee, contributing competences in the field of accounting and the industry in which Śnieżka operates.

Independence: NO
Member of the Audit Committee
